Description:
Ulrike Ottinger’s film explores love and marriage in South Korea, inspired by traditional Korean wedding chests. It examines both ancient and modern rituals, showing how tradition and modernity intertwine. The film journeys from shamanic practices and temples to contemporary Seoul, where traditional vendors stand alongside modern businesses catering to weddings. Using cinematic imagery, Ottinger blends mythology, rites, symbolism, and dreams of love with elements of Western culture. This acclaimed documentary captures the complexities of new mega-cities navigating contradictory societal forces.
